Abstract
We prepared the geometric isomers of decahydro-2-naphthols as the source materials for the synthesis of poly(decahydro-2-naphthyl methacrylate)s [poly(DNMA)-I, -II, -III, and -IV] including alicyclic ester groups with different geometric structures. The geometry and conformational dynamics of the decahydro-2-naphthyl moieties were investigated by NMR spectroscopy and DFT calculations. We synthesized each isomer of the methacrylic monomers, polymerized them, and investigated the optical, thermal, and mechanical properties of poly(DNMA)s with different isomer compositions. The Tg values of the poly(DNMA)s were in the following order: 139.3 °C for poly(DNMA)-II < 142.7 °C for poly(DNMA)-I < 146.2 °C for poly(DNMA)-III < 152.9 °C for poly(DNMA)-III/IV.
